Summary

Bayside Shopping Centre, owned by Vicinity Centres, is a major regional shopping hub located 53km south of Melbourne’s CBD. Spanning 89,821 square metres with over 145 specialty stores, it attracts more than 12.2 million visitors annually. Known for its complex infrastructure and services, Bayside holds impressive sustainability credentials, including a 4 Star Green Star – Performance, 5.5 Star NABERS Energy, and 5 Star NABERS Water ratings.

A thorough assessment of building services was conducted to develop a long-term capital plan focused on sustainability and efficiency. Criticality assessments helped prioritise expenditures based on business risks, while data from historical work orders and service reports provided insights into failure rates. Collaborating with site management and subcontractors deepened our understanding of failure patterns, leading to smarter asset management strategies. These included extending the life of select assets by replacing specific sub-systems, balancing risk management and budgetary considerations.
